Navigating by sight – SpaceNews


SAN FRANCISCO – A NASA formation-flying experiment exhibits the promise of autonomous navigation for satellite tv for pc swarms.

The 4 cubesats within the Starling Formation-Flying Optical Experiment, or StarFOX, calculate their orbits by combining visible photos from star trackers with robotics algorithms.

“Such a visual-navigation system on a swarm of satellite tv for pc can be utilized to navigate round Earth,” Simone D’Amico, Stanford College affiliate professor of aeronautics and astronautics and founding director of Stanford’s Area Rendezvous Lab, informed SpaceNews. “Since we don’t use GPS, it may be used to fly across the moon or round Mars with an elevated stage of autonomy.”

Mission operators talk with Starling, a swarm of 4 cubesats launched on a Rocket Lab Electron in July 2023, as a single entity. StarFOX is certainly one of 4 experiments testing communications, navigation and autonomy applied sciences for future swarms.

Total, Starling has proven sufficient promise for NASA to increase the mission. Starling, initially scheduled to conclude in Might, has been prolonged till December 2025.

Blended Algorithm

Earlier flight exams of vision-based navigation featured one observer satellite tv for pc and one goal. And the observer knew the goal’s preliminary location.

StarFOX has proven it’s attainable for 4 satellites to navigate autonomously “and not using a priori data and with out maneuvers to enhance navigation accuracy,” D’Amico mentioned.

Key to the success of StarFOX are a set of algorithms referred to as angles-only Absolute and Relative Trajectory Measurement System (ARTMS), in keeping with a paper offered on the latest Small Satellite tv for pc Convention in Logan, Utah. ARTMS combines algorithms for image-processing and preliminary orbit willpower with an algorithm that refines estimates on the state of the swarm over time.

“We have now realized what accuracies are achievable utilizing typical star trackers used on smallsats,” D’Amico mentioned. “And now we have realized how we are able to enhance that efficiency, for instance, by exchanging these visible measurements which might be taken by a number of observers.”

Starling satellites change information by way of inter-satellite hyperlinks.  

“If a number of observers see a standard goal within the subject of view, exchanging these measurements and fusing them into our algorithms can decide extra precisely and sooner the orbit of that object,” D’Amico mentioned. The information change additionally improves every satellite tv for pc’s data of its personal orbit, he added.

Testing Required

Regardless of its success, StarFOX gives a cautionary story.

“We realized the significance of rigorous, full, hardware-in-the-loop testing carried out on the bottom earlier than flight,” D’Amico mentioned. “So as to make it inside the constraints of funds and time, we did particular person unit exams and sacrificed among the built-in exams that may have given us the complete confidence on the execution of the experiments.”

Early within the Starling mission, flight software program crashed. By the usage of an engineering mannequin on the bottom, a NASA Ames Analysis Heart software program engineer mounted the issue might by allocating further reminiscence.

“There was a penalty to pay when it comes to prices, when it comes to loss experiment time and so forth,” D’Amico mentioned.
